use crate::commands::command::RunnablePerItemContext;
use crate::errors::ShellError;
use crate::parser::hir::SyntaxShape;
use crate::parser::registry::{CommandRegistry, Signature};
use crate::prelude::*;
use std::path::PathBuf;
pub struct Remove;
#[derive(Deserialize)]
pub struct RemoveArgs {
pub target: Tagged<PathBuf>,
pub recursive: Tagged<bool>,
}
impl PerItemCommand for Remove {
fn name(&self) -> &str {
"rm"
}
fn signature(&self) -> Signature {
Signature::build("rm")
.required("path", SyntaxShape::Pattern)
.switch("recursive")
}
fn usage(&self) -> &str {
"Remove a file, (for removing directory append '--recursive')"
}
fn run(
&self,
call_info: &CallInfo,
_registry: &CommandRegistry,
raw_args: &RawCommandArgs,
_input: Tagged<Value>,
) -> Result<OutputStream, ShellError> {
call_info.process(&raw_args.shell_manager, rm)?.run()
}
}
fn rm(args: RemoveArgs, context: &RunnablePerItemContext) -> Result<OutputStream, ShellError> {
let shell_manager = context.shell_manager.clone();
shell_manager.rm(args, context)
}
